The Butler Bulldogs will travel to East Lansing, Michigan to face the 18th-ranked Michigan State Spartans at the Jack Breslin Student Events Center on Friday evening with the game scheduled to start at 6:30 PM ET and will air on Fox Sports 1.

It doesn’t seem like that long ago that the Butler Bulldogs were the measuring stick for mid-majors as they made it to the National Championship game in back-to-back seasons and almost defeated Duke off a three-point shot attempted by Gordon Hayward, however, the shot rolled out of the rim and then Butler lost the next season in the 2011 NCAA Tournament to the UConn Huskies and have not made it past the Sweet 16 since that game. The Bulldogs missed the NCAA tournament last season for the 5th consecutive season as they finished with a record of 14-18 which included a record of 6-14 in the Big East. Butler was eliminated early in the Big East Tournament as they lost to the St. John’s Red Storm in the opening round by a score of 63-76. This season, the Butler Bulldogs are projected to be the 3rd worst team in the Big East, however, they enter this game with a record of 3-0 following wins at home against the Eastern Michigan Eagles by a score of 94-55, the SE Missouri State Redhawks by a score of 91-56, and the ETSU Buccaneers by a score of 81-47, however, they will be taking a step up in competition when they travel to face the Michigan State Spartans on Friday evening.

Michigan State had high expectations this season as they entered the season ranked 4th in college basketball, however, they have already lost two of their first three games on the year with a loss at home against the James Madison Dukes by a score of 76-79 in overtime and the Duke Blue Devils on Tuesday in the Champions Classic by a score of 65-74. The Spartans continue to struggle shooting the ball as they are shooting 41.2% overall and have been one of the worst teams in college basketball beyond the arch as they are only shooting 16% from 3-point range. They did improve their 3-point percentage when they faced Duke as they shot 31.6% from 3-point range. Their struggles against Duke came from the line as they only had a 58.3% free throw percentage which was their season low and outside of the game against Southern Indiana they have shot below 65% this season. Their defense has been decent, however, if they are going to meet the expectations they had entering the season then they will have to shoot the ball better to win games.
